CapeMayCountyHerald.com: NOAA, Coast Guard Recover Dead Whale Off Cape May


Photo Credit: The crew of Coast Guard Cutter Finback

The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ration and the Coast Guard recovered a right whale carcass approximately 46 miles off the coast of Cape May Thurs., July 1. The dead whale will be brought ashore for NOAA scientists to conduct a necropsy to take biological samples and to determine the cause of death.

The whale carcass was initially reported 46 miles off Cape May Tuesday by the crew of the Coast Guard Cutter Legare, which was returning to Portsmouth, Va., following a 33-day deployment in the Mid-Atlantic. A NOAA aircraft provided an updated position of the whale on Wednesday when the carcass was observed 69 miles off Cape May.
